1. Use Boiling Water
When confronted with a clogged sink, the first thing you should try is to put boiling thin down the drain. That is about one of the most straightforward treatment to stopped up sinks and also drainages. Boiling water aids neutralize the bits as well as particles triggering the blockage, specifically if it's oil, soap, or grease fragments, as well as oftentimes, it can flush it all down, and your sink will certainly be back to regular.
Since hot water can thaw the lines and also cause more damages, do not try this technique if you have plastic pipes (PVC). If you utilize plastic pipes, you might intend to adhere to using a plunger to get particles out.
Using this approach, activate the faucet to see how water flows after putting warm water away. If the clog continues, attempt the process once again. Nevertheless, the obstruction could be a lot more persistent in some cases and also require more than just boiling water.

4. Baking Soda and Vinegar
Instead of using any form of chemicals or bleach, this technique is safer and also not damaging to you or your sink. Baking soda and also vinegar are day-to-day residence things made use of for many other points, and they can do the technique to your kitchen area sink.
Firstly, get rid of any kind of water that is left in the sink with a cup.
Then put an excellent quantity of cooking soda away.
Pour in one cup of vinegar.
Seal the drainage opening and also allow it to choose some mins.
Pour warm water down the drain to disappear other stubborn residue and also bits.
Following this basic approach might work, as well as you can have your cooking area sink back. Repeat the process as much as you deem needed to free the sink of this particles completely.

How to Unclog a Kitchen Sink
Take the Plunge
Start your efforts by plunging. Use a plunger with a large rubber bell and a sturdy handle. Before getting to work on the drain, clamp the drain line to the dishwasher. If you don t close the line, plunging could force dirty water into the dishwasher.
Fill the sink with several inches of water. This ensures a good seal over the drain.
If you have a double sink, plug the other drain with a wet rag or strainer.
Insert the plunger at an angle, making sure water, not air, fills the bell.
Plunge forcefully several times. Pop off the plunger.
Repeat plunging and popping several times until the water drains.Clean the Trap
The P-trap is the curved pipe under the sink. The trap arm is the straight pipe that attaches to the P-trap and runs to the drain stub-out on the wall. Grease and debris can block this section of pipe. Here s how to unclog a kitchen sink by cleaning out the trap:
Remove as much standing water from the sink as possible.
Place a bucket under the pipe to catch the water as it drains.
Unscrew the slip nuts at both ends of the P-trap. Use slip-joint pliers and work carefully to avoid damaging the pipes or fasteners.
If you find a clog, remove it. Reassemble the trap.
If the P-trap isn t clogged, remove the trap arm and look for clogs there. Run the tip of a screwdriver into the drain stub-out to fetch nearby gunk.Spin the Auger
With the trap disassembled, you re ready to crank the auger down the drain line.
Pull a 12-inch length of cable from the auger and tighten the setscrew.
Insert the auger into the drain line, easing it into the pipe.
Feed the cable into the line until you feel an obstruction. Pull out more cable if you need to.
If you come to a clog, crank and push the cable until you feel it break through. The cable will lose tension when this happens.
Crank counterclockwise to pull out the cable, catching the grime and debris with a rag as the cable retracts.
